once upon a sting---don't play with bees!!!!

By the time I was twelve, I had mastered the task of cleaning and feeding the chickens, mucking out the rabbits and feeding, as well as watering them and tending the vegedable garden. My grandfather said at the beginning of the Easter holidays, he would start showing me how to look after the bees. This he told me in the kitchen---on my last day at school just before the holidays. My nan, who was sitting in her rocking chair in the corner, looked up and said "you should teach young Jim to do better than you taught his Uncle Jim at his age."
